I am planning for new petrol hatch back with following criterias:-
> Budget: 5-5.5 Lakhs
> New or Used: New Car
> Location: Bangalore
> Top Five Priorities: Safety, Comfort, Low Maintenance, Design, Audio
> Monthly Running: Less than 500km
> Type of Fuel: Petrol / Diesel
> For What Purpose: Occasional Highway Trips and rarely in city
> Seating Capacity: Maximum 5 Adults
> Type of Segment: Hatchback

with this I have narrowed down my preferences to the following cars:-
1.Volkswagen Polo Trendline 1.2L
2.Ford Figo Titanium
3.i10 Sportz
4.Swift Vxi

Please let me know which one should i opt for and I wanted to know if I can opt for polo as worried about maintenance cost.

Request you all to suggest me the best hatch back even apart from my list.

Since your monthly running is low,go for a petrol. Would suggest the swift or Brio SMT(O). But the swift does not full fill your safety requirement and the brio has the brio has a better engine too. Figo is also good but fords ASS and the Polo has a three pot motor. The I10 is ok but quite cramped. So try the Brio or if you can stretch your budget,Swift ZXI.

I agree with the Brio looks part but Hondas ASS is superb and inexpensive.
But VW maintenance is quite high. The new Sail is also a brilliant car. The petrols a quick car,stable and good handling too. Its also very spacious but lacks features and the interior does not have that charm of the swift. But the main problem is the resale value and if it will sell or not. But its also a great car.

Between the I20 or Polo,I would recommend the I20. Why? Because its more VFM,more spacious,more refined and has better A.S.S. The Polos quality is unmatched though.
